Prospects for the practical application of the open phenomenon "Abnormally high amplitude of self-oscillation" for the fluid flow

Abstract

The outflow of an incompressible fluid from a rectangular opening covered by a semicircular arched element is considered. The self-oscillatory expiration regime is numerically investigated. The computational algorithm implemented in the STAR-CCM+ software package includes a grid approximation in space, an implicit time integration method, and an algebraic multi-grid method for solving systems of algebraic equations. A variant of the hole geometry with an aspect ratio of is considered. An explanation is given to the mechanism of the self-oscillatory process. The distribution of oscillation amplitude values in space at the exit from the hole is determined. Some possibilities of practical application of the described phenomenon are determined.
